Posterior Lumbar Fusion with Discectomy

The patient presented with severe lumbar spondylosis. The surgeon accomplished posterior lumbar interbody fusion L3-L4 and L4-L5 using autologous bone graft, discectomy of L3-L4 and L4-L5, packing of the disc space with autologous bone that was harvested from the right iliac crest, and pedicle screw instrumentation. What are the appropriate ICD-10-PCS procedure code assignments? Is the discectomy coded separately or is it considered inherent to the fusion? ...
